Lake Zoar is a great outdoor destination for kayaking, swimming, hiking and picnicking. With more than 900 acres of waters bordered by shoreline vistas, it is a great place for recreation.


Find beautiful Colonial homes surrounded by nature in Sandy Hook CT!



Lake Zoar also provides fishing and boating with its 10 river-like miles. Steep, forested banks along most of its length make any outdoor experience seem out of this world.

Are you a fan of Colonial-styled homes? If you are, then you're in for a treat in Sandy Hook CT!


Almost 100 real estate properties are for sale near Lake Zoar and most of them are Colonial homes. This also includes homes built with the Colonial contemporary or antique style.


The homes you'll see features centered panel front doors topped with rectangular windows. Cornice, embellished with decorative moldings, usually dentil work, and multi-pane windows are also everywhere.


A wonderful feature that these properties have is the wooded surroundings. Since Lake Zoar has forested banks, it's no wonder that the homes are going green too!


Bedrooms range from 2 to as high as 5. The high-end properties in the Sandy Hook area offer living spaces as large as 5,412 sq ft and lot sizes of 30.56 !


Inside these homes you'll find wide plank floors with plenty of large windows. This gives the homes that bright, airy feeling in the middle of nature.


Kitchens offering high ceilings and granite counters are also available. Generous size center islands, double wall ovens and pantries make these kitchens dreamy.

How to Sell Your Lake Zoar Home If You Have Pets



How to Sell Your Lake Zoar Home If You Have Pets

 

Selling a Lake Zoar real estate is a complex process, but it can become even more challenging when you have pets in your home. Surprisingly, owning a pet can reduce your home’s value. That is because your furry friends can cause serious damage to your property.  So what should you do if you have pets at home?  Here are some easy tips on how to sell your home with this concern in mind:
Make your Lake Zoar waterfront home selling process smooth even if you own a pet with these 5 helpful tips!
Temporarily relocate
It will be easier to show your home to buyers of Lake Zoar homes for sale if your pets are not present when they arrive.  If you have a friend or a family member that you are comfortable leaving your animal with, it will give you the chance to eliminate all the signs of having a pet in the house. Relocating your pets can also help prevent them from causing further issues. Keep in mind that some buyers consider pets a huge turn-off when looking at potential homes they may want to own.

Fix any damage
Make sure to spend time and repair damage caused by your pets before showing your home to buyers looking for Lake Zoar waterfront homes.  Remember that any form of damage is a turn-off. While you love your pets, they will inevitably destroy something including carpets, furniture, hardwood flooring, walls, doors, turf in your yard and your fence. Some of the repairs may be inexpensive while others may require a great deal of money. Either way, the value you will get for your house will be well worth paying for the repairs.

Take away signs of having pets
You want buyers to envision themselves as the next owner of the home. However, having pet stuff around your home may distract them. Before you open the doors of your home to potential buyers, put away all pet toys, bedding, litter boxes and food – preferably at another location besides your home. You may also want to remove all photos where your pet is present as well. Remember that removing extra pet clutter is an important part of preparing your home for sale.

Clean the rugs
As much as you want, you cannot control pet accidents. Sometimes, they even happen right before a scheduled showing. What should you do then? The answer is in your kitchen. Baking soda does wonders for neutralizing odors. Sprinkle a thin layer over carpets and let it set overnight. Vacuum the next day for a fresh scent.

Have your home checked for fleas
While you may believe that your pets are clean and do not carry any fleas, it is still better to have your home checked for fleas. There are many ways to know if there are fleas in your home. If you suspect that you have some, you should have a professional inspect further. Remember that fleas and pest can turn off buyers. Make sure to get rid of them before any potential buyer walks through your home.

Having pets is always an issue when selling a home, but with these tips you can snatch a quick sale for the best price.
